The capsule pods were wonderful, fully encased, good ventilation, and high ceilings. My bed on the top had a sloped ceiling which I could almost stand up in. This is what they mean by "small but spacious" Good wifi. I checked in at 1am (thank you soooo much for having a 24 hour front desk) The person checking me in didn't speak english but he was very kind and attentive. I dropped 100 baht when pulling out my passport. He found me to return it. The venue is super cool, it is a real theater located in a very authentic part of town. Not touristic at all. Many food hawker stalls. I would definitely stay again to explore the neighborhood on foot. The theater is decorated with many shots of films like a museum. If you're a movie buff or enjoy watching films, you'll love this! I also heard they screen really old movies and have popcorn every night! I didn't try the breakfast as I heard it was kind of bland - I went for the cafe instead which had a good breakfast selection at tourist prices. Comfy directors chairs.

Ibooked a six-bed room this time, which had its own private bathroom. Everything was great: the room had high ceilings, plenty of space, and comfortable, clean beds. The only downside was that the shared bathroom in the six-bed room had the shower and toilet in the same space. There was a partition, but the water from the shower would leak onto the floor next to the toilet, which wasn't very pleasant for the next person using the bathroom. The location was great, though - it's in a really historic area and not too far from the subway station. The hotel itself was converted from an old movie theater, so the surrounding area is full of long-established restaurants and local vendors. It's got a real authentic vibe and a great sense of place. For the price, I highly recommend it!
